The collective body of government or organizational officials, often implying excessive bureaucracy or rigid rules and procedures.
Example Sentence
Dealing with the officialdom at the city hall can sometimes be a slow and frustrating process.
Usage Note
Use "officialdom" to refer to the group of people in charge, especially in government or large organizations, when you want to emphasize their collective power, rules, or the sometimes slow and complex nature of their processes. It often carries a slightly critical or impersonal connotation, highlighting the system rather than individual people.
